Car history:
This is a frame off/nut and bolt restored 1968 Corvette Convertible 427 Tri Power 435hp 4 Speed with only 65,456 miles. It is a NUMBERS MATCHING motor, transmission and rear end. The current and third owner has had this car for 25 years since 1991. Just about every piece of this car has been replaced or restored. The car was disassembled, the body separated from the frame, the body stripped and prepped and repainted in January of 2006. The car was then reassembled with many new parts, restored original parts and a few original parts that were good enough to reuse as is. The frame was media blasted, painted, and reassembled with all new suspension components, Bilstein shocks, stainless brake lines, gas tank, new body mounts. The original numbers matching 427ci 435hp engine was rebuilt to factory specs with all new internals. It was also dipped clean and repainted correct. The original 3x2 tri power intake and carbs were rebuilt, installed and adjusted. All new hoses, belts, radiator, clutch, motor mounts, stainless exhaust, wiring and all the other ancillary parts are new but the original alternator was rebuilt and installed. The braking system is new from front to back and top to bottom including stainless sleeved brake calipers and silicone brake fluid. We have carefully documented all the work with every receipt as well as notes from the rebuild. The original Muncie M22 transmission and 3.55:1 Heavy Duty Positraction rear end were also rebuilt and restored to factory specs. I have provided all of the stamping numbers and codes from the car farther down the page. The body was painted back to the correct #976 International Blue before being reassembled. New bonding strips were installed before paint and body work. The car comes with extra paint for future use. All of the body gaps are very nice and even, the bird cage and frame are original and solid. The original bumpers were rechromed and are beautiful. The new BF Goodrich Radials are wrapped around 8 Rally Wheels with trim rings and hubcaps. The original hubcaps are included with the sale but not on the car. The original Firestone Super Sport Wide Oval spare tire is in the spare tire carrier and still holds air. The convertible top is brand new and put down for the first time in these pictures. The interior sports the original dashboard and steering wheel as well as the seats in #414 Medium Blue vinyl. All of the gauges and accessories work as designed including the power windows, wipers, headlights less the fiber optics in the console. The carpet, door panels, visors and other trim pieces are brand new. While the interior is currently set up as a radio delete, the original radio is included. This car runs and drives flawlessly. It drives straight with no pulling and stops on a dime. As you can see from the pictures, this car is a show stopper for the casual observer up to and including the seasoned collector. This car was restored to be a long term part of a small collection but life has a way of changing ones priorities. I have almost 200 additional hi resolution pictures available by email showing every area of the car. ooTrim 414 - Medium Blue Vinyl Paint 976 - International Blue (2,473 built this color in 1968 model year) Date D10 (December 10, 1967 build date) Front Engine Pad - TT024IR (IR codes to 427ci 435hp L71 w/ manual trans and 2,898 built w/ this motor) and 189404361 (VIN) Engine Block Casting - GM3, CONV 2, 3916321 (427ci, 390, 400, 430, 435 hp) Transmission - 3884685, 3925660, P8T04 (P=Muncie, 8=1968 model year, T=December, 04=4th day - Built Dec 4th, 1967), 3915091 M-22 Rear End - 1AZ10 1167 codes to 3.55:1 heavy duty positraction 427ci - Built Nov 1967) 3x2 Tri Power Intake - 3919852 = 1968 Alternator - 1100696 42A 7J5 12V Neg (350, 390, 400, 430, 435hp transistor ignition built Sept 5, 1967) Some where I read that this car has heavy duty brakes as that is all that was available with this 427 engine option.
